Yes, if your business falls under a regulated sector, you are legally required to provide AML training for relevant staff.
You’re required to have AML procedures in place if your business falls into any of these categories:
Accountants and bookkeepers
Estate agents and letting agents
Financial services providers
Legal professionals
High-value dealers
Crypto asset businesses
AML training should be conducted at least annually, or whenever there is a significant regulatory update or staff role change.
